Temporary privileges process

Department of Medicine Temporary Med Staff Privileges
Division, Department, Chief of Staff, and Medical Director:





The Division Head sends email/memo to Service Chief (Dr. Anawalt/Dr. Broudy) with a
request to issue temporary privileges to a physician, based on an urgent clinical need.
The Service Chief forwards this email to the Chief of Staff Elect, Dr. Jo Davies
Once the Chief of Staff reviews and gives approval, the request is forwarded to the
Medical Director(s) at the facility where temporary privileges are requested (UWMC,
HMC, SCCA)
The Medical Director responds with his/her approval and lets OMSA know that approval
has been given to process temporary privileges
The Division Coordinator fills out the “Request for Temporary Medical Staff Privileges”
(available online, at DoMWeb) and forwards the form for Service Chief’s signature.
Service Chief’s office submits form to OMSA.
OMSA:








Verifies approval
Obtains Provider ID and billing number
Runs NPDB (National Profile Database)
Verifies medical license/expiration date
Establishes Board certification and highest level of training
Obtains WA state criminal history background check
Verifies existing privileges
Forwards completed request for temporary privileges along with the initial application
packet to Medical Director’s office along with attestation, 3 letters of reference,
immunization form, patient confidentiality and privilege form
Credentialing Committee:

The facility’s (or facilities’) credentialing committee (at UWMC: Medical Staff Advisory
Committee, aka MSAC, at HMC: Medical Executive Board, aka MEB) votes on awarding
the Temporary Privileges (UWP/NCQA); three votes are needed
Once the Medical Director’s office notifies OMSA that the committee has approved the
application and that Temporary Privileges have been granted, OMSA sends out emails to the
provider, the Department Chair’s office, UWP, and the Division.
Provider will be on Temporary Privileges until the full committee approval process for a final
vote on the initial application has been completed.
